Scotney Castle

Painting Description

Scotney Castle is now a picturesque piece of sculpture in the centre of a garden in Kent. During our four months in Kent in 1998, we visited this garden several times monitoring the change in the scenery as the seasons changed. Atop a nearby hill, a serious Victorian mansion looks down its nose at this beautiful relic resting serenely in the centre of a small lake. For me, the Trout Pub nearby was an added inducement to return to this pretty spot.
